33/** @file
34 * @brief Z8530 keyboard port driver.
35 */
36
37#include <ipc/ipc.h>
38#include <ipc/bus.h>
39#include <async.h>
40#include <sysinfo.h>
41#include <kbd.h>
42#include <kbd_port.h>
43#include <sys/types.h>
44#include <ddi.h>
45
46#define CHAN_A_STATUS 4
47#define CHAN_A_DATA 6
48
49#define RR0_RCA 1
50
51static irq_cmd_t z8530_cmds[] = {
52 {
53 .cmd = CMD_PIO_READ_8,
54 .addr = (void *) 0, /* will be patched in run-time */
55 .dstarg = 1
56 },
57 {
58 .cmd = CMD_BTEST,
59 .value = RR0_RCA,
60 .srcarg = 1,
61 .dstarg = 3
62 },
63 {
64 .cmd = CMD_PREDICATE,
65 .value = 2,
66 .srcarg = 3
67 },
68 {
69 .cmd = CMD_PIO_READ_8,
70 .addr = (void *) 0, /* will be patched in run-time */
71 .dstarg = 2
72 },
73 {
74 .cmd = CMD_ACCEPT
75 }
76};
77
78irq_code_t z8530_kbd = {
79 sizeof(z8530_cmds) / sizeof(irq_cmd_t),
80 z8530_cmds
81};
82
83static void z8530_irq_handler(ipc_callid_t iid, ipc_call_t *call);
84
85int kbd_port_init(void)
86{
87 async_set_interrupt_received(z8530_irq_handler);
88 z8530_cmds[0].addr = (void *) sysinfo_value("kbd.address.kernel") +
89 CHAN_A_STATUS;
90 z8530_cmds[3].addr = (void *) sysinfo_value("kbd.address.kernel") +
91 CHAN_A_DATA;
92 ipc_register_irq(sysinfo_value("kbd.inr"), sysinfo_value("kbd.devno"),
93 sysinfo_value("kbd.inr"), &z8530_kbd);
94 return 0;
95}
96
97static void z8530_irq_handler(ipc_callid_t iid, ipc_call_t *call)
98{
99 int scan_code = IPC_GET_ARG2(*call);
100 kbd_push_scancode(scan_code);
101
102 if (cir_service)
103 async_msg_1(cir_phone, BUS_CLEAR_INTERRUPT,
104 IPC_GET_METHOD(*call));
105}
